Katrina Flyover is a new MSN Virtual Earth-powered service that lets you
click on camera icons scatted throughout New Orleans to get a birds-eye,
before-and-after view of the city in the aftermath of HurricaneKatrina.
Google HurricaneKatrina Search
is a new service from Google that allows you to do two things -- search for
people who may be missing and search only against sites deemed to be relevant to HurricaneKatrina.

Craigslist Versus Katrina from Wired looks at how users of the Craigslist listing service are posting
offers of aid and housing to victims of HurricaneKatrina. See also HurricaneKatrina Resources & Aerial Images from the blog yesterday, for...
